如何在Excel中提取超链接地址
在日常使用Excel工作表的过程中,您可能会发现,超链接的具体地址只有在鼠标悬停时才会显示。如果您希望直接提取超链接的地址,可以按照以下步骤进行操作。
步骤一:进入VBA环境
首先,打开您的Excel文档,然后按下 Alt + F11 键,这将带您进入VBA(Visual Basic for Applications)环境。在这里,您可以编写自定义代码,以提取超链接的地址。
步骤二:插入模块
在VBA环境中,您需要右击“Microsoft Excel 对象”,然后在弹出的扩展菜单中选择 插入,接着选择 模块,这将为您创建一个新的模块。

步骤三:输入代码
在打开的模块编辑界面中,您需要输入一段代码,以实现超链接地址的提取。请按照下面的示例代码进行输入:
Function GetActAddress(HlinkCell)
Application.Volatile True
With HlinkCell.Hyperlinks(1)
GetActAddress = IIf(.Address = "", .SubAddress, .Address)
End With
End Function
步骤四:返回Excel界面
完成代码输入后,返回到Excel界面。接下来,在超链接所在单元格右侧的单元格中输入 =GetActAddress,然后按下回车键。这时,您将会看到自定义函数的效果,如图所示。
步骤五:确认提取结果
在输入完整的单元格引用后,再次按下回车键,您即可看到超链接地址成功提取,如图所示。
通过以上步骤,您便可以轻松地在Excel中提取超链接的地址,简化了工作流程,提高了效率。